April is a seasonal transition month for Provo in the Northern Hemisphere. Daylight length changes more noticeably now, with sunrise and sunset shifting week by week as the sun moves between solstice extremes.

April daylight summary

  • Sunrise shifts 44m earlier from the start to the end of the month.
  • Sunset shifts 30m later from the start to the end of the month.
  • Total daylight changes by 1h 13m longer by month end.

Key April Statistics

  • Earliest sunrise: April 1 at 7:13 AM
  • Latest sunrise: April 30 at 6:29 AM
  • Earliest sunset: April 1 at 7:50 PM
  • Latest sunset: April 30 at 8:20 PM
  • Day length change: +1h 13m from start to end of month

April averages

  • Average sunrise: 6:50 AM
  • Average sunset: 8:05 PM
  • Average day length: 13h 15m

Daily Sun Times for April 2026

DateSunriseSunsetDay LengthMorning Golden HourEvening Golden Hour
Apr 17:13 AM7:50 PM12h 37m7:13 AM - 7:49 AM7:14 PM - 7:50 PM
Apr 27:11 AM7:51 PM12h 40m7:11 AM - 7:47 AM7:15 PM - 7:51 PM
Apr 37:09 AM7:52 PM12h 43m7:09 AM - 7:45 AM7:16 PM - 7:52 PM
Apr 47:08 AM7:53 PM12h 45m7:08 AM - 7:44 AM7:17 PM - 7:53 PM
Apr 57:06 AM7:54 PM12h 48m7:06 AM - 7:42 AM7:18 PM - 7:54 PM
Apr 67:05 AM7:55 PM12h 51m7:05 AM - 7:41 AM7:19 PM - 7:55 PM
Apr 77:03 AM7:56 PM12h 53m7:03 AM - 7:39 AM7:20 PM - 7:56 PM
Apr 87:01 AM7:57 PM12h 56m7:01 AM - 7:38 AM7:21 PM - 7:57 PM
Apr 97:00 AM7:58 PM12h 58m7:00 AM - 7:36 AM7:22 PM - 7:58 PM
Apr 106:58 AM7:59 PM13h 1m6:58 AM - 7:34 AM7:23 PM - 7:59 PM
Apr 116:57 AM8:00 PM13h 4m6:57 AM - 7:33 AM7:24 PM - 8:00 PM
Apr 126:55 AM8:01 PM13h 6m6:55 AM - 7:31 AM7:25 PM - 8:01 PM
Apr 136:54 AM8:02 PM13h 9m6:54 AM - 7:30 AM7:26 PM - 8:02 PM
Apr 146:52 AM8:03 PM13h 11m6:52 AM - 7:28 AM7:27 PM - 8:03 PM
Apr 156:51 AM8:04 PM13h 14m6:51 AM - 7:27 AM7:28 PM - 8:04 PM
Apr 166:49 AM8:05 PM13h 16m6:49 AM - 7:26 AM7:29 PM - 8:05 PM
Apr 176:48 AM8:06 PM13h 19m6:48 AM - 7:24 AM7:30 PM - 8:06 PM
Apr 186:46 AM8:07 PM13h 21m6:46 AM - 7:23 AM7:31 PM - 8:07 PM
Apr 196:45 AM8:09 PM13h 24m6:45 AM - 7:21 AM7:32 PM - 8:09 PM
Apr 206:43 AM8:10 PM13h 26m6:43 AM - 7:20 AM7:33 PM - 8:10 PM
Apr 216:42 AM8:11 PM13h 29m6:42 AM - 7:18 AM7:34 PM - 8:11 PM
Apr 226:40 AM8:12 PM13h 31m6:40 AM - 7:17 AM7:35 PM - 8:12 PM
Apr 236:39 AM8:13 PM13h 34m6:39 AM - 7:16 AM7:36 PM - 8:13 PM
Apr 246:37 AM8:14 PM13h 36m6:37 AM - 7:14 AM7:37 PM - 8:14 PM
Apr 256:36 AM8:15 PM13h 39m6:36 AM - 7:13 AM7:38 PM - 8:15 PM
Apr 266:35 AM8:16 PM13h 41m6:35 AM - 7:12 AM7:39 PM - 8:16 PM
Apr 276:33 AM8:17 PM13h 43m6:33 AM - 7:11 AM7:40 PM - 8:17 PM
Apr 286:32 AM8:18 PM13h 46m6:32 AM - 7:09 AM7:41 PM - 8:18 PM
Apr 296:31 AM8:19 PM13h 48m6:31 AM - 7:08 AM7:42 PM - 8:19 PM
Apr 306:29 AM8:20 PM13h 50m6:29 AM - 7:07 AM7:42 PM - 8:20 PM
